Guangzhou sits at the heart of the Greater Bay Area’s disposable hygiene supply chain. Upstream nonwovens, SAP, and pulp are mature; manufacturing clusters concentrate in Baiyun, Huadu, and Huangpu. The city is close to three major ports—Nansha, Yantian, and Shekou—which streamlines FCL/LCL export. This list focuses only on factories located inside Guangzhou city limits that have real production or OEM/ODM projects.

Sourcing Guide (From Project Kickoff to PSI)

Verifying a Factory

  1. Licenses & scope: Business license scope should explicitly cover disposable hygiene/diaper manufacturing.
  2. Third-party audits: Prefer ISO 9001/14001 for systems; social audits (BSCI/SEDEX) when retail channels require it.
  3. Sampling & AB tests: Run 2–3+ rounds varying core weight, SAP ratio, core design, waist/closure components; log test data.
  4. AQL Inspection: Pre-shipment by a third party; common baseline General Level II with AQL Major 2.5 / Minor 4.0. Lab performance per GB/T 28004 (diapers)—penetration, rewet, leakage, breathability, tensile, tape fatigue.

How Core & Materials Drive Cost/Performance

  • Basis weight (gsm): Higher gsm ⇒ higher absorbency & “fuller” handfeel but higher cost; night use and larger sizes trend heavier.
  • SAP ratio: Typical working window ~35–45% (balanced with fluff pulp). Higher SAP improves locking/rewet but can trade off softness & cost.
  • Topsheet/Backsheet: Hot-air nonwoven, pearl textures, and breathable films influence comfort, rash risk, and unit cost.
  • Key tests: Rewet, side-leak, air permeability, waist/tape strength.

Sampling, MOQ & Lead Time (Typical)

  • Sampling: ~7–15 days (longer if custom printed bags/cartons).
  • MOQ: FCL strongly preferred (cost/stability).
  • Lead time: 15–45 days from artwork & packaging lock; first orders often longer.

Compliance & Labeling (EU/US)

  • Usually treated as general consumer goods (not medical devices). Plan for chemical safety (e.g., REACH-related screens, fluorescent whitening agent checks), correct language/marking, and retailer-specific rules (CPSIA/State regs in the US as applicable). Consider skin irritation/sensitization and microbial limits testing for premium SKUs.

Shipping

  • FCL: Lower unit logistics cost, fewer touch points, better schedule control.
  • LCL: Lower entry quantity but higher unit cost and more handling.
  • Port choice: For Guangzhou loading, start with Nansha; evaluate Yantian/Shekou when route rates/sailing frequency or consolidations are better.

FAQ (Buyer Prompts)

  • Can you do private label (OEM/ODM)? Any sample/plate fees?
    Most Guangzhou factories offer OEM/ODM. Expect die-cut + cylinder/plate + sample fees; often refundable against mass orders per contract.
  • How do I balance basis weight/SAP with cost and absorbency?
    Define target absorbency & rewet limits by user scenario (day/night, NB/L/XL). Run small-scale trials and road tests, then fine-tune gsm and SAP in increments.
  • Extra compliance/labels for EU/US?
    Plan basic chemical screens (e.g., REACH-related, fluorescent-free), correct packaging language and origin/lot/size markings; follow channel/retailer rules.
  • Can you make fluorescent-free/fragrance-free/hypoallergenic SKUs?
    Yes—specify at RFQ. Validate via third-party tests (fluorescent agent, skin irritation patch).
  • Factory audit and inspection workflow?
    Common flow: desk review → on-site audit (BSCI/SEDEX or customer audit) → CAP → trial run → PSI (SGS/BV/ITS) → loading witness (optional).
  • Ports & FCL/LCL?
    For Guangzhou, Nansha typically wins on drayage/time. FCL is cheaper and more reliable; LCL suits small pilots but costs more per unit.
